resizing DataGrid using flash actionscript
import fl.controls.DataGrid;
var dg:DataGrid = new DataGrid();
dg.addColumn("Column1");
dg.addColumn("Column2");
dg.addItem({Column1:"Row 1 Col 1", Column2:"Row 1 Col 2"});
dg.addItem({Column1:"Row 2 Col 1", Column2:"Row 2 Col 2"});
dg.width = 100;
dg.setSize(100,20);
dg.rowCount = dg.length;
dg.move(10, 10);
addChild(dg);
create DataGrid instance using flash actionscript
import fl.controls.DataGrid;
var dg:DataGrid = new DataGrid();
dg.addColumn("Column1");
dg.addColumn("Column2");
dg.addItem({Column1:"Row 1 Col 1", Column2:"Row 1 Col 2"});
dg.addItem({Column1:"Row 2 Col 1", Column2:"Row 2 Col 2"});
dg.width = 300;
dg.rowCount = dg.length;
dg.move(10, 10);
addChild(dg);
editable and non-editable textinput using flash actionscript
import fl.controls.CheckBox;
import fl.controls.TextInput;
var cB:CheckBox = new CheckBox();
cB.label = "Edit Text";
cB.addEventListener(Event.CHANGE, cB_edit);
cB.move(10, 5);
addChild(cB);
var tI:TextInput = new TextInput();
tI.editable = false;
tI.move(17, 30);
addChild(tI);
function cB_edit(evt:Event):void {
tI.editable = cB.selected;
}
masked password in textArea with flash actionscript
import fl.controls.CheckBox;
import fl.controls.TextArea;
var cB:CheckBox = new CheckBox();
cB.label = "Display as Password";
cB.addEventListener(Event.CHANGE, cB_password);
cB.width = 200;
cB.move(10, 5);
addChild(cB);
var tA:TextArea = new TextArea();
tA.displayAsPassword = false;
tA.width = 125;
tA.move(15, 40);
addChild(tA);
function cB_password(evt:Event):void {
tA.displayAsPassword = cB.selected;
}
disable Slider component using flash actionscript
import fl.controls.Slider;
import fl.controls.CheckBox;
import flash.display.*;
var checkBox:CheckBox = new CheckBox();
checkBox.label = "enabled";
checkBox.addEventListener(Event.CHANGE, checkBox_action);
checkBox.move(20,5);
addChild(checkBox);
var slider:Slider = new Slider();
slider.enabled = false;
slider.move(30, 40);
addChild(slider);
function checkBox_action(evt:Event):void {
slider.enabled = checkBox.selected;
}